Skip to content

Commit 0ef3977

Browse files
committed
bugfix: ignore internal endpoints in acquireHostList
1 parent 5ff399e commit 0ef3977

File tree

1 file changed

+7
-2
lines changed

1 file changed

+7
-2
lines changed

src/main/java/com/arangodb/internal/net/ExtendedHostResolver.java

Lines changed: 7 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-31,7 +31,12 @@
3131
import org.slf4j.Logger;
3232
import org.slf4j.LoggerFactory;
3333

34-
import java.util.*;
34+
import java.util.ArrayList;
35+
import java.util.Arrays;
36+
import java.util.Collection;
37+
import java.util.Collections;
38+
import java.util.List;
39+
import java.util.Map;
3540

3641
/**
3742
* @author Mark Vollmary
@@ -130,7 +135,7 @@ private Collection<String> resolveFromServer() throws ArangoDBException {
130135
final Collection<Map<String, String>> tmp = arangoSerialization.deserialize(field, Collection.class);
131136
endpoints = new ArrayList<>();
132137
for (final Map<String, String> map : tmp) {
133-
endpoints.addAll(map.values());
138+
endpoints.add(map.get("endpoint"));
134139
}
135140
}
136141
return endpoints;

0 commit comments

Comments
 (0)